West Indies scored 124/8 against Pakistan in the 4th T20I in Port of Spain today. The hosts are looking to level the four-match series with Pakistan leading 2-1. Hasan Ali and Shadab Khan took two wickets each as Pakistan restricted West Indies to 124/8 in the fourth T20 international in Port of Spain.


Chadwick Walton was the top scorer for West Indies with a 40 on 31-balls. The West indies have their sights set on levelling the four-match series when they take on Pakistan in the fourth T20 international in Port of Spain. Pakistan was victorious in the first two matches, but the hosts came back strongly thanks to their 7-wicket win on Saturday.

West Indies took a settled and smooth start against Pakistan but this time Pakistan success to take the wicket of Lewis who was scored a brilliant 91 in last match with 9 sixes. After that Walton was the man who was hitting for West indies and can be a danger for Pakistan but Shadab took his wicket.

Chadwick was another batsman who started hitting to Pakistani bowlers but on other end wickets were falling and Chadwick was not out at the other end and 20 overs were ended. Pakistan have to win this match to win series 3-1. West Indies have to win the match to level the series.
